Example Prompt
Analyze this deposition transcript of John Smith, former VP of Engineering. CASE CONTEXT: - Breach of software license agreement - Key issues: scope of license, usage tracking, breach knowledge ANALYSIS REQUIRED: 1. PAGE-LINE SUMMARY For each significant topic, provide: Page:Line | Topic | Summary of testimony 2. KEY ADMISSIONS Identify any testimony where witness admits facts favorable to our case 3. INCONSISTENCIES Flag any testimony that contradicts: - Documents in the record - Prior statements - Common sense or established facts 4. CROSS-EXAMINATION QUESTIONS Based on weaknesses in testimony, draft 10 questions for cross-examination 5. NARRATIVE SUMMARY Provide a 2-page narrative summary suitable for the trial team 6. EXHIBIT REFERENCES List all exhibits discussed and their significance
Frequently Asked Questions
Can Claude compare testimony across multiple witnesses?
Yes. Upload multiple transcripts and instruct Claude to identify where witnesses' testimony aligns or conflicts.
What about video deposition references?
Claude works with text transcripts. For video, use the transcript with timecodes. Claude can reference specific testimony for clip identification.
How accurate are the page-line references?
Claude's references are based on the transcript format provided. Verify important references in the original transcript.
